Made in the USA from the late 50's to early 70's and sporting a horizontal shaft Briggs and Stratton engine, the sears custom line has always taken a back seat to the better advertised Cub cadet, and John Deere lawn and suburban garden tractors, but this machine gives up nothing and will out live the newer sears craftsman tractors around the yard and garden. The idea behind the madness is to be able to connect a generator or a log splitter to the output shaft of the engine, reducing the maintenance of all my farm tools to just one engine, plus re powering with one larger Briggs and Stratton engine will be easy and cheap enough.
